WebJun 10, 2013 · Psalm 57 — David is the author of this Psalm and the theme of the Psalm is God’s faithfulness in times of trouble. This was probably written when David fled from Saul and hid in a cave. Let’s take a look at David’s character. This was probably written when David fled from … can rimadyl cause pancreatitis in dogsWebJul 2, 2014 · Eventually, however, God delivers David from Saul—and the king pens a psalm of praise to his Savior. This song is actually recorded twice in the Bible: once in Second Samuel, and again in the book of Psalms ( Ps 18). ... This is the one David had them sing when the temple was commissioned.
